NFRC - Product Presentation (Proctor Air) + Questions & Discussion

An overview of the Proctor Air air and vapour permeable roofing underlay membrane and its use in non-ventilated roof constructions. This presentation covers its function, benefits, and applications in a practical context. Topics include:

  • Condensation Control Fundamentals
  • Construction Membrane Types and Functions
  • Roof Types and Configurations
  • Product Composition
  • Applicable BS 5250 and BS 5534 Guidance

NFRC - RIBA - Pitched Roof Design Considerations: Energy, Moisture & Air Permeability

This CPD gives an overview of pitched roof design considerations and regulations in the UK and Ireland, along with discussing the type of construction membranes used as pitched roof underlays and the effect their performance has on design. It also discusses the implications of hygrothermal focused roof design on the overall building energy performance. By the end of the CPD you should have a greater understanding of:

  • Roof types outlined in BS5250:2021 Code of Practice
  • Different roof types and associated hygrothermal strategies
  • Pitched roof underlay types
  • The effects of membrane properties on design requirements
  • Factors affecting pitched roof moisture control
